本文将系统地介绍嘉定H5小程序高级开发技巧,包括常用的API函数、交互设计方法、性能优化手段、框架的选取以及代码的管理等方面。通过深度分析这些技巧,我们可以更好地开发优化、高效的小程序,为用户带来更好的体验。
1. 常用的API函数
针对嘉定H5小程序开发,我们需要掌握一系列常用的API函数,这些函数具有广泛的应用场景,包括界面跳转、网络请求、本地存储、系统配置以及数据渲染等方面。我们需要深入了解每个函数的使用方法、传参方式、回调函数等细节,并结合具体业务场景,合理地调用这些函数,保证小程序的稳定性和性能。
2. 交互设计方法
交互设计是小程序开发中极为重要的一环,一个好的交互设计可以让用户更好地理解和使用小程序,提升用户体验。在嘉定H5小程序开发中,我们需要考虑页面布局、控件样式、动画效果、响应速度等方面因素,构建一个直观、美观、快速响应的小程序。同时,我们需要根据用户反馈及时修正小程序的不足之处,提高用户满意度。
3. 性能优化手段
性能优化是小程序开发中的重要环节,尤其针对嘉定H5小程序这样的复杂场景,我们需要采取一系列的手段来提高小程序的运行效率和稳定性。这些手段包括减少网络请求、减小页面渲染开销、单独引用js文件等措施,还可以使用一些优化工具来对小程序进行检测和修正,确保小程序能够在多种手机型号上正常运行。
4. 框架的选取
框架是小程序开发中的核心模块,它决定了我们开发的方式和效率。在嘉定H5小程序开发中,我们需要选择一个高效、稳定、易用的框架来进行开发。常用的框架包括Vue.js、React和AngularJS等,我们需要仔细比较各个框架的特点、功能和性能,选择一个适合自己业务需求的框架,并在实际开发中加以应用。
5. 代码的管理
代码管理是小程序开发中必不可少的环节,它直接关系到我们的开发效率和质量。在嘉定H5小程序开发中,我们需要采用一些代码管理工具和方法,包括Git版本控制、模块化开发、代码注释、代码规范等方面,这些方法可以帮助我们更好地管理代码,防止出现一些意想不到的错误,提高开发效率和质量。
总之,嘉定H5小程序的开发需要掌握一系列高级技巧,这些技巧涵盖了各个方面,包括API函数的使用、交互设计方法、性能优化手段、框架的选取以及代码的管理等方面。只有深入理解这些技巧,合理地应用于实际开发中,我们才能开发出真正优秀的小程序,为用户带来更好的体验。
本文主要介绍了嘉定H5小程序高级开发技巧。文章从小程序基础介绍,讲解了小程序底层原理,深入探讨了小程序组件和API的使用技巧,以及一些实用的开发工具和优化方式。通过本文的学习,读者可以更深入地了解和掌握小程序的开发技巧,提高开发效率和用户体验。
1. 嘉定H5小程序入门介绍
嘉定H5小程序是一种轻量级的应用,可以在微信、支付宝等平台上运行,无需下载安装。相比于传统的App,小程序具有占用内存小、运行速度快、开发成本低等优点。小程序主要使用HTML、CSS和JavaScript进行开发,基础语法类似于Web前端开发。开发者可以使用微信开发者工具等集成开发环境(IDE)来进行开发,大大提高了开发效率。
2. 嘉定H5小程序底层原理
嘉定H5小程序采用WebView进行运行,具有前端渲染和后台运行的特点。小程序底层采用类似于浏览器的渲染引擎,在用户操作时向后台请求数据,并将数据渲染到前端页面。小程序在启动时会进行页面预加载,提高用户体验。小程序的网络请求、事件响应等操作都是异步的,不会阻塞用户界面,可以提升用户体验。
3. 嘉定H5小程序组件和API的使用技巧
小程序提供了丰富的组件和API,可以方便地实现各种功能。常用的组件包括button、view、input、scroll-view等,可以通过WXML和WXSS来进行布局和样式设置。API包括页面跳转、网络请求、数据存储、事件响应等功能,可以使用JavaScript来编写。在使用组件和API时,需要注意组件和API的属性和方法,可以通过官方文档来进行学习和了解。
4. 嘉定H5小程序开发工具和优化方式
微信开发者工具是小程序开发的必备工具,提供了预览、调试、上传等功能,可以大大提高开发效率。同时,为了提高小程序的性能和用户体验,还需要注意优化小程序的许多方面,包括图片和视频的压缩、代码的压缩和混淆、使用小程序云开发等。
5. 嘉定H5小程序未来发展和趋势
小程序已经成为互联网应用的重要形态之一,未来还将继续发展和壮大。随着小程序技术的不断更新和完善,小程序将可以实现更加复杂的功能和更高的性能,成为更加实用和便捷的互联网应用。同时,小程序的国际化发展也将更加广阔,可以为更多的用户提供服务。
本文介绍了嘉定H5小程序的高级开发技巧,从小程序基础介绍,讲解了小程序底层原理,深入探讨了小程序组件和API的使用技巧,以及一些实用的开发工具和优化方式。通过本文的学习,读者可以更深入地了解和掌握小程序的开发技巧,提高开发效率和用户体验。未来,小程序将继续发展和壮大,为用户提供更加实用和便捷的服务。